ENG 028 - Structure of English


30 Item Multiple Choice Test
SET B

Direction: Read the questions carefully and encircle the correct answer.

1. Which preposition should be used in the following sentence? "The book is ______ the table."
A. On. B.in. C. at D. under

2. Select the appropriate preposition to complete the sentence: "Froilan is waiting ______ the bus stop."
A. In B.at C. on. D. by

3. Choose the correct preposition: “Arvin is good ____ playing the guitar.
A. at B. on. C. in. D. with

4. You placed the book on the desk. How do you describe this action?
A. I placed the book under the desk. B. I placed the book in the desk.
C. I placed the book beside the desk. D. I placed the book on the desk.

5. It is a word that shows the relationship between a noun (or pronoun) and other words in a sentence. often used to indicate
location, direction, time, and relationships between different elements in a sentence.
A. Adjective B. Noun. C. Conjunction D. Preposition

6. Please select the adverb in this sentence: She saved money diligently so that she could travel around the world.
A. Travel. B. around. C. diligently D. saved

7.Which adverb of time is used in the sentence "She will arrive tomorrow morning"?
A. Will. B. arrive C. tomorrow D. morning

8. What adverb of time is present in the sentence "They are leaving early for the concert tonight"?
A. early B.Tonight. C. leaving. D. They

9. In the sentence "I need to go _____ to get some fresh air," which adverb should be used?
A. There. B.quickly. C.outside. D.fast

10. Identify the adverb of negation in the sentence "I can't believe how quickly he finished the race."
A. Quickly. B.can't. C.believe. D.how

11. Which of these sentences uses an adverb of frequency?


A. The cat sat on the mat. B.The children played happily.
C. He always helps his friends. D.The dog barked loudly.

12. Which adverb can be used to express both time and place?
A. How. B.Here C.Always. D.Quickly

13. Which of these sentences uses an adverb that is misplaced?


A. The dog barked loudly at the mailman. B.The boy ran quickly down the street.
C. I ate the delicious pizza very quickly. D.She sang beautifully, but sadly, she was off-key.

14. Which sentence uses an adverb correctly to modify another adverb?


A. The runner ran very quickly. B.The dog barked extremely loud.
C. The sun shines brightly. D.The cat walked slowly.

15. Which adverb indicates the degree or extent of something?


A. Slowly. B.Very. C. Yesterday. D.Happily

16. Which of the following is NOT a characteristic of adverbs?


A. They modify verbs, adjectives, or other adverbs.
B. They often end in "-ly".
C. They can be used to describe how, when, where, or to what extent something happens.
D. They always change the meaning of the noun they modify.

17. Which sentence uses an adverb correctly to modify an adjective?


A. The movie was extremely funny. B. The car drove fast.
C. The children played happily. D. The bird sang beautifully.
18. Which of these words is NOT an adverb?
A. Quickly. B. Always C. Here D. Beautiful

19. Which adverb is used to emphasize a statement?
A. Slowly. B. Indeed. C. Nicely. D. Suddenly

20. Which of these adverbs is an intensifier?


A. Slowly. B. Very. C. Here. D. Yesterday

21. Which of the following is NOT modified by the adverb?


A. A verb. B. An adjective. C.A preposition. D. Another Adverb

22. Which of the following statements is NOT true about adverbs?


A. Adverbs can modify adjectives.
B. Adverbs can have comparative and superlative forms to show degree.
C. We use more and most, less and least to show degree with adverbs.
D. Adverbs always end with -ly.

23. In which sentence does the adverb modify an adjective?


A. The car drives smoothly. B. She was extremely happy about the news.
C. They arrived late to the party. D. He sings beautifully.

24. Which of the following sentences uses an adverb to indicate degree?


A. He almost finished the assignment. B. She dances well.
C. They went outside quickly. D. The train arrived late.

25. Which sentence contains an adverb modifying another adverb?


A. She spoke very softly. B. The dog barked loudly.
C. He will arrive soon. D. They are always early.

26. Which of the following sentences contains an adjective?


A. She sings beautifully. B. He quickly ran to the store.
C. The tall building was impressive. D. They will arrive soon.

27. Which of the following adjectives is in its comparative form?


A. Good B. Better C. Best D. Well

28. Identify the adjective in the following sentence: "The cake was delicious."
A. The B. Cake C. Was D. Delicious

29. Choose the correct form of the adjective to complete the sentence: "She is the ____ student in the class."
A. Smart B. Smarter C. Smartest. D. More smart

30. In which sentence is the adjective used correctly?


A. She is more tall than her brother.
B. This is the most beautifulest dress I have ever seen.
C. He is as strong as an ox.
D. The quick brown fox jumps over the laziest dog.
